Swedbank to unite Baltic branches under a new holding company in Latvia 25 Swedbank in Lithuania. / J. Stacevičiaus/LRT nuotr. Swedbank Group has decided to form a new holding company in Latvia to unite its branches in the Baltic states, according to Swedbank’s press release quoted by the Baltic News Network. WIth this move, the bank plans to adapt its strategy more flexibly in accordance with Latvia’s market and monitoring requirements. Recently, Swedbank’s branches in Estonia and Latvia have been involved in high-scale corruption scandals. The US authorities are currently investigating its activities. Swedbank AB will be the holding company’s complete shareholder and the new company will be a 100 percent owner of subsidiaries in Latvia, Lithuania, and Estonia. The holding company’s board chairman will be council chairman in each of the subsidiary banks in Baltic States. ....
